Handover: Exportron retry queue

Hi Mira — handing over the failed-export retries. Exports that hit a timeout land in the retry queue and get three attempts with backoff; after that they're parked and need a manual requeue from the admin panel. Watch for customers reporting duplicates — that usually means a double requeue. The current retry settings are as follows.

settings of bajog-fawig:
oliael:
  log_level: warn
  metrics_host: metrics.oliael.zemvarsys.internal
  pin: 0267
  pool_size: 32

Alert: ParcelPing webhook delivery failures exceeded 5% over the last 15 minutes. The Driftwood Logistics endpoint is returning intermittent 502s, so tracking updates for affected shipments are queued, not lost. Retries run every two minutes with exponential backoff. If the backlog tops 10k events, escalate to the integrations rotation. Triage steps and queue dashboards are on the internal page below.

runbook for badug-kadup: https://confluence.zemvarlabs.internal/projects/browse/display/projects/bd1b

Subject: Handover — Lanternfold exports

Taking over release duty from Priya this cycle. Known issue: report exports in Lanternfold still render timestamps in server-local time when a plugin omits the tz field; fix ships in 5.2. Plugin authors should pass explicit zone identifiers until then — do not rely on the fallback. Export jobs scheduled near DST transitions may duplicate or skip an hour. Everything else is stable. Plugins must be re-signed against the 5.2 chain before the cutover. The active deploy key follows.

signing key of bagap-yawep = bky13_TbfT6ZMUoGJo2

Cleaning-crew members from Larkspun Services may access the Hollowbrook office between 19:00 and 22:00 on weekdays only. Each crew member must sign the facilities ledger on arrival and departure, and must remain within the zones marked on the posted floor plan. Storage rooms, the records annex, and the server alcove remain strictly off limits. Crew leads should carry the laminated authorisation card at all times and use the service-entrance pass shown below.

turnstile pass: bdg-WBD-5